Analytical psychology is acknowledged for its historic and geographical examine of myths as a way to deconstruct, With all the assist of symbols, the unconscious manifestations of the psyche. Myths are stated to symbolize directly the elements and phenomena arising from your collective unconscious and although they may be subject to alteration of their detail via time, their importance stays comparable. Although Jung relies predominantly on Christian or on Western pagan mythology (Historic Greece and Rome), he holds that the unconscious is pushed by mythologies derived from all cultures.

The initial layer referred to as the personal unconscious is actually similar to Freud’s Variation from the unconscious. The non-public unconscious is made up of temporality forgotten info and properly as repressed memories.

The collective unconscious, an idea by Carl Jung, refers to shared, inherited unconscious knowledge and activities across generations, expressed by common symbols and archetypes prevalent to all human cultures.
